Sicily is the largest island (25,426 sq. km.) in the Mediterranean; it is also the most important economically and has the richest heritage of history and art.
Its geographical particularity lies in its compact but varied orographical structure, the uniformity of its rivers, the typically Mediterranean climate and the insularity which has helped Sicily to experience homogeneous historical development with originality of custom, art and culture.
Together with the minor Aeolian islands (the Lipari), Ustica, Egadi, Pantelleria and the distant Pelagie, Sicily is the most extensive region in Italy, though it has only the fourth highest population. The population density is slightly higher than the national average.
The island is bounded by the Tyrrhenian Sea to the north, the Ionian to the east and the Sicilian Sea to the south-west; the Strait of Messina separates it from Calabria.

Messina in Sicilia - Il Porto
Il porto è fisicamente formato, in gran parte, dalla penisoletta di San Ranieri, la quale serve a descrivere la caratteristica falce, che, secondo la tradizione, derivata dal significato della parola greco-allogena zancle, falce, avrebbe dato alla città il primitivo nome. Sulla sua punta esterna è il forte Campana, ordinato da Carlo V e realizzato nel 1546. Esso serviva a chiudere l'insieme di efficenti batterie difensive installate lungo l'intero arco del porto al fine di respingere le ricorrenti incursioni delle armate turche. Per far luogo allora alla sua costruzione venne distrutto uno dei primi conventi cristiani che accoglieva monaci basilani e che si intitolava al San Salvatore. Questo nome è poi rimasto per indicare la parte estrema della penisola ove nel secolo XVII, ingrandendosi il forte Campana, furono create nuove opere fortificate.
